The Finance Coordinator reports to the Finance Manager and serves as a key member of the Finance Team within the Support Services function at MAG Lebanon. This position is responsible for overseeing the day-to-day financial operations and ensuring the implementation of robust internal controls across the Lebanon programme. The Finance Coordinator supports the full financial management cycle, ensuring strict adherence to MAG’s financial policies, donor requirements, and audit standards. In addition, the role ensures the timely processing of programme and operational cashbooks, verifying that all supporting documentation complies with MAG’s quality and compliance standards.
Principal Responsibilities
- Responsible for posting the cashbooks after the review of the finance manager of Lebanon programme on monthly basis.
- Responsible for journal (Prepayment) and payroll cashbook.
- Responsible for keeping track to ensure the minimum balance of cash and bank accounts are updated as per the latest country’s memo.
- Maintain effective control over cash book and bank and ensure that cash in hand reconciles with what is registered in cash books.
- Manage the SDDs for international staff in updating HQ payroll team on monthly basis and reimbursing them in country.
- Responsible for preparing the monthly grant spending reports (Budget vs. Actuals - BvAs) of assigned projects and submission for FM , represent the BvA meeting in absence of CFM along analysis for the SMT , including administrative/operational projections; work with Finance and operations team to ensure project projections are updated; together with logistics teams review BvAs and procurement expenditures and forecasts to ensure projects implementation are on time and within targets and budgets.
- Responsible for preparing all personnel cost documentation required for audits, ensuring full compliance with MAG’s internal financial procedures and donor audit requirements.
- Assist in the preparation of the forecast for grant and quarterly reforecast exercises with HQ in Adaptive insights
- Assist in payroll verification in the absence of Finance Manager
- Responsible for Payroll cashbook
- Assist the CFM on the monthly balance sheet and make sure that all accounts are reconciled with accounting software (PSF).
- Responsible for cash in the office (safe & cash holder).
- Assist the CFM by reviewing the monthly NSSF reports and payment along with the quarterly Tax report declarations
- Act in the role of the Finance Manager when needed, ensuring continuity of financial operations, oversight of financial reporting, and adherence to MAG’s financial policies and procedures.
- Responsible for the preparation of allocation cashbook of 89 LB pool accounts as per agreed allocation table in country.
- Responsible for the review of local partner advance requests and expense/financial reports and provide feedback to CFM
- Participating in the absence of CFM in procurement tender committee meetings and representing finance team
- Responsible Fuel Cost share allocation upon liaison with Fleet responsible staff.
Essential Requirements
- Bachelor’s degree in accounting, Finance, Business Administration, or a related field.
- Minimum of 5 years of relevant experience in accounting, financial reporting, or grant management, preferably within an INGO or donor-funded organization.
- A certification in financial management or grant accounting is an asset.
- High level of accuracy, attention to detail, and strong organizational skills.
- Ability to manage multiple priorities and meet strict deadlines under pressure.
- Strong knowledge of accounting principles, financial systems, and reconciliations.
- Experience with audit preparation and donor compliance.
- Good understanding of Lebanese labor laws, NSSF contributions, and tax declaration processes with familiarity with reporting to relevant authorities is a preferable asset.
- Experience in budgeting, payroll, and cost allocation.
- Strong interpersonal and communication skills; able to collaborate effectively with non-finance colleagues.
- Demonstrated integrity, discretion, and commitment to confidentiality.
- Flexible and adaptable, with the ability to act in the role of the Finance Manager when required.
- Fluency in Arabic and English (written and spoken).
- Proficient in Microsoft Excel and other MS Office applications.
